Page History
...
- Release Notes- Should contain a very basic overview of the Release. Make sure the Release number is updated here!
- NOTE: For minor releases (bug-fix-only releases), you may want to leave all information about the previous major release, and just enhance the content to state that this was a bug-fix release, and list any new contributors, etc.
- Installation - Obviously make sure the Installation Documentation is updated for this Release
- Upgrading a DSpace Installation - Same for the Upgrade Documentation, make sure it's up to date
- History- Make sure the online History for this latest Release is included. You should be able to just copy the last version's page and update the version numbers. For example, copy the previous release's page, and change as follows:
- You'll notice all the JIRA history is generated via the
jiraissue
plugin. In theurl
argument for that plugin, you should find the DSpace version number embedded in the querystring like: "... AND+fixVersion+%3D+%223.0%22 ..." If you look closely, you'll see the 'fixVersion' is set to "3.0" in that search string. All you should need to do is update that version number (and the plugin will now search for tickets closed for 4.0) Also make sure to update the
title
argument for thatjiraissue
plugin to list the proper version number informationNote Obviously, this is just a brief reminder of important areas of Documentation which always require updates. There's surely other areas, like Configuration section, which will require some updates for your release.
- You'll notice all the JIRA history is generated via the
Create the PDF version of Wiki Documentation
Export the latest Wiki-based Documentation as PDF.
Info | ||
---|---|---|
| ||
See this DSpace documentation management guide: How To Export Downloadable Docs from Wiki |
Double Check Contents of all README (and similar) files in GitHub
...
Code Block |
---|
localhost$ cd target/checkout/dspace/ localhost$ mvn package -Pdistributions [INFO] Scanning for projects... [INFO] [INFO] ---------------------------------------------------------------------------- [INFO] Building DSpace Assembly and Configuration 3.0 [INFO] ---------------------------------------------------------------------------- .... [INFO] --- maven-assembly-plugin:2.2.1:single (default) @ dspace --- [INFO] Reading assembly descriptor: src/main/assembly/release.xml [INFO] Reading assembly descriptor: src/main/assembly/src-release.xml [INFO] Building zip: [full-path-to-dspace-src]/dspace/target/dspace-3.0-release.zip [INFO] Building tar: [full-path-to-dspace-src]/dspace/target/dspace-3.0-release.tar.gz [INFO] Building tar: [full-path-to-dspace-src]/dspace/target/dspace-3.0-release.tar.bz2 [INFO] Building zip: [full-path-to-dspace-src]/dspace/target/dspace-3.0-src-release.zip [INFO] Building tar: [full-path-to-dspace-src]/dspace/target/dspace-3.0-src-release.tar.gz [INFO] Building tar: [full-path-to-dspace-src]/dspace/target/dspace-3.0-src-release.tar.bz2 [INFO] ------------------------------------------------------------------------ [INFO] BUILD SUCCESS [INFO] ------------------------------------------------------------------------ |
Create the PDF version of Wiki Documentation
Export the latest Wiki-based Documentation as PDF.
Info | ||
---|---|---|
| ||
See this DSpace documentation management guide: How To Export Downloadable Docs from Wiki |
Upload to SourceForge
Upload both the source and binary releases to Sourceforge.net. You can either upload them via the web interface, or copy them over via scp
or other command line tools. If you want to copy the files from command line, follow the directions found here: http://apps.sourceforge.net/trac/sourceforge/wiki/File%20management%20service. You should expect a few minutes' delay before the individual files become visible on SourceForge.
...